Gastrointestinal disorders (FGIDs) affecting up to 40% of individuals, characterized by chronic digestive symptoms without clear structural causes. Rasayana therapy from Ayurvedic medicine is explored as a novel strategy for enhancing cell-mediated immunity and managing FGIDs. The literature search focused on Rasayana therapy's impact on gastrointestinal health and disease prevention, integrating clinical trials and experimental studies. Rasayana formulations like Chyawanprash and Ashwagandha demonstrate significant immunomodulatory effects, activating immune cells and balancing cytokines to support immune homeostasis in the gastrointestinal tract. These formulations also possess antioxidant properties crucial for gut health and immune function. Clinical studies provide strong evidence of Rasayana therapy's efficacy in improving immune responses and managing FGIDs.
